    Abstract: An X-ray detecting apparatus constructed as the present invention receives an X-ray passing through a subject during a window time in which the subject is exposed to the X-ray, and converts the X-ray into an electrical signal to output the electrical signal as a video signal. The X-ray detecting apparatus subtracts the offset video signal determined according to the window time in the video signal to generate a real video signal representing the X-ray result for photographing the subject.

    Abstract: In an organic light-emitting display device and a method of manufacturing the same, the organic light-emitting display device includes: a silicon layer formed on a substrate; and a thin film transistor (TFT) and an organic light-emitting device that are formed on the silicon layer. The silicon layer comprises a conductive doping silicon portion for forming a part of an active layer included in the TFT and an insulating intrinsic silicon portion surrounding the doping silicon portion. According to the organic light-emitting display device of the present invention, manufacturing costs may be reduced due to a reduction in the number of masks, and the manufacturing process of the organic light-emitting display device may be simplified.

    Abstract: There are provided a TFT, a TFT substrate using the TFT, a method of fabricating the TFT substrate, and an LCD. The TFT includes a source region, a drain region, and a gate electrode having an opening. The opening of the gate electrode is to enhance the light sensing ability of the TFT when it is used as a light sensor, since light is incident into a region where the opening is formed. The TFT including the gate having the opening can be used in a substrate of a flat display or an LCD using such a substrate. The above TFT can sense light incident from outside the display to adjust the brightness of the screen according to the external illumination.
